Chapter 1

Thea

The first time I laid eyes on Evan Anderson, I knew he was trouble. Not the loud, reckless kind but the kind that smiled like he knew something you didn’t. The kind that made your skin prickle for reasons you couldn’t explain. It was in his eyes, mischievous and reckless. And that smirk of his, God, I hated that smirk.

Evan Anderson was everything this school worshipped; he is popular and admired. Teachers liked him, students flocked around him, and as the captain of the football team, he might as well have owned the place. Tall, sharp features, olive skin that glitters in the sun. Blue eyes that girls wrote poetry about. Wavy hair that always looked effortlessly perfect, but I didn’t see the appeal. I could name at least five boys who looked just like him, but somehow, Evan stood out, and that irritated me more than I cared to admit.

It wasn’t a secret that we didn’t get along. We avoided each other like the plague, and I preferred it that way. As far as I was concerned, he existed in a completely different world from mine. And I was perfectly fine keeping it that way. Until…

“He’s failing math." I blinked, staring at Ms. Debby from across her desk.

“If he wants to make the national football team and get into a good college, he needs to pass,” she continued. I folded my arms slowly. 

“Okay, and what does that have to do with me?” I asked, my eyebrows raised. She sighed.

“Thea, you’re our best student. You’ve won multiple academic awards. You’re the only one who can tutor him,” she says, but I stare at her, unamused.

“Get someone else to do it, Ms. Debby. Landon is excellent at math. I’m sure he’d be happy to help,” I say to her, giving her an option. 

“We tried that,” she said, sliding a file toward me. I hesitated before opening it and immediately wished I hadn’t. My eyes widened like saucers as I looked at Evan's grades. Each semester was worse than the last. His grades weren’t just bad; they were catastrophic.

“He’s been failing since freshman year. Landon tried, but Evan is difficult,” she said as I closed the file. 

“I’m sure he won’t listen to me either. This is a terrible idea,” I said flatly. Ms. Debby leaned forward, her voice softening.

“Think about what you stand to gain,” she says, but I don't respond.

“Academic recognition, extra credit, and a strong recommendation letter from the principal himself,” she said, and that made me think.

“Westbridge is your dream college, isn’t it?” She asked. I nodded slowly. Ms. Debby knew she had put me in the corner like she wanted. My chest tightened slightly.

“One recommendation could make the difference, Thea. Your record is already impressive, but this?” She said with a smile. 

“This would make it exceptional,” she continued. I hated how convincing she sounded. Westbridge wasn’t just my dream school. It was the plan and the goal, everything I had been working hard for. I have been doing everything I could to get a perfect record, and this could help. But at what cost? I exhaled slowly, rubbing the back of my neck.

“I can’t believe you are thinking about this, Thea. All you need to do is endure Evan for the rest of the senior year and get a good recommendation. After high school, this would all be history,” she says, her voice full of hope and expectations. Ms. Debby was right, and I hated it. This was a good deal to ignore. I sighed. A recommendation from Principal Smith, I would get the scholarship in a heartbeat. I sighed, rubbing my hands down my face.

“Fine,” I muttered.

“I’ll try. But if he refuses to cooperate, I’m done,” I said strictly. Relief flooded her face as a wide smile sat on her face. 

“Thank you, Thea, for considering it. I am sure Evan would cooperate with you,” she says, and I put on a tight smile. 

“You can leave for your class now,” she continued. I nodded stiffly and stood, grabbing my bag. What had I just agreed to? The further I walked from Ms. Debby's office, the more I realized how she had manipulated me into agreeing. By the time I reached my locker, regret had already settled in. This was the third week of senior year. I had a plan: stay invisible, keep my grades perfect, and graduate without distractions. Now Evan was part of that plan. I let my forehead rest briefly against the locker door cursing myself out.

“Great,” I muttered. “Just great.”

“What are you doing?” The high-pitched voice said, and I flinched, nearly dropping my bag. I turned to find Bridget and Mia staring at me.

“Why would you scare me like that?” I snapped, calming my racing heart. 

“We’ve been calling your name; you were completely out of it,” Bridget said. I sighed.

“You’re not going to believe this,” I mumbled, telling them what just occurred. They gasped.

“No way,” Bridget breathed.

“And you agreed?” Mia added, eyes wide.

“I didn’t think it through,” I groaned, hating myself more for agreeing. 

“I mean, tutor him? Evan? He’s arrogant, annoying, and a stupid jerk. I can’t bear to be in the same space with him, and now I have to trade my evenings and possibly weekends for him. This is exasperating!” I exclaimed. Bridget and Mia looked back at me with wide eyes, and I was confused by their reaction. 

“Wow,” came the voice that I recognized anywhere, even in my sleep. I froze, and slowly, I turned. Evan stood a few steps away, hands in his pockets, his usual expression unreadable. His friends lingered behind him. Of course he heard everything.

“I didn’t know you hated me that much,” he said calmly. I rolled my eyes, refusing to give him the satisfaction of seeing me in a total mess.

“What do you want?” I snapped. His gaze lingered on me for a second too long.

“You’re my tutor now; you might want to watch your attitude, nerd,” he snapped. I ignored him, opening my locker and dropping my bag. I took the books that I needed, shutting my locker harder than necessary.

“Meet me in the library during lunch. We’ll set a schedule for this tutor,” I said sharply. He raised his eyebrows. 

“And don’t waste my time,” I continued. For a moment, neither of us moved. Then I walked past him, heading to class. I could feel his eyes on me the entire way down the hallway. Heavy and unsettling. And for the first time since agreeing to this ridiculous arrangement, an impossible thought slipped into my head. This wasn’t going to end well. Not for him. And definitely not for me.
